Mr. Shernoff is a nationally recognized trail blazer who has been called the pioneer of insurance bad faith after persuading the California Supreme Court to establish new case law that permits plaintiffs to sue insurance companies for bad faith seeking both compensatory and punitive damages (Egan v. Mutual of Omaha). He has since continued to obtain significant verdicts and court decisions which have shaped this area of law as well as written three books and roughly 100 articles on the topic of insurance bad faith.

The full extent of the business interruption caused by the novel coronavirus is unknown, but the losses are already catastrophically high. The stock market's recent plunge over coronavirus fears was the largest since the financial crisis in 2008. Businesses should be considering whether any of these coronavirus-related losses are covered under their policies.
